The country also know as country of copper?

Zambia---------- The word copper is derived from the name of Cyprus - the country of copper in the antiquity. Now the biggest production is from Chile (South America).- A region in the United States (in Michigan) has the historical name Copper country.- Today Zambia isn't the most important producer. What is Patty Loveless most known for?

Patty Loveless is most known as a country singer. She emerged as a country star in 1986 with her first self titled album. She truly came into her own in the early 1990's.


What is Carl Smith famous for?

Carl Smith was an American country singer born in 1927. He was known as 'Mister Country' and was famous for being one of country's most successful male artists during the 1950's. He is also a member of the Country Music Hall of Fame.
